Quick Guide: How Long to Wait Between Spray Paint Coats (Tips)

The duration required between applications of aerosolized paint is a critical factor in achieving a smooth, durable finish. This interval represents the period necessary for the solvents within the paint to evaporate partially, allowing the initial coat to tack up, but not fully dry. This “tacky” stage provides an optimal surface for subsequent layers to properly adhere, minimizing the risk of runs, drips, or other surface imperfections. Consider, for example, that applying a second coat too soon can dissolve the first, leading to sagging, while waiting excessively may result in poor adhesion and potential peeling.

Adhering to recommended drying times enhances the overall quality and longevity of the paint job. Adequate inter-coat drying prevents issues such as solvent entrapment, which can compromise the film’s integrity and lead to premature failure. 7+ Tips: How Long to Wait to Wash Hair After Perm

The recommended duration before shampooing newly permed hair is typically 48 to 72 hours. This waiting period is essential for allowing the chemical bonds within the hair shaft to fully stabilize and set the desired curl pattern. Premature washing can disrupt this process, leading to a loss of curl definition and potentially causing the perm to loosen significantly.

Adhering to this timeframe is crucial for ensuring the longevity and effectiveness of the perming treatment. Historically, longer waiting periods were advised due to less advanced perming solutions. Modern formulations often allow for a slightly shorter wait, but the principle remains the same: complete stabilization of the curl structure is paramount. 8+ Tips: How Long to Wait to Eat After Fillings?

The duration of time an individual should refrain from consuming food following a dental filling procedure is contingent upon the type of filling material employed. Traditional amalgam fillings, composed of metal alloys, typically necessitate a shorter waiting period compared to composite, or tooth-colored, fillings. This waiting period allows the filling material to adequately harden and stabilize within the prepared tooth cavity, thereby preventing premature displacement or damage from masticatory forces. For instance, a patient receiving an amalgam filling may be advised to wait approximately one hour before eating, while a patient receiving a composite filling might experience different instructions based on the curing process used.

Adhering to the recommended waiting period is crucial for the longevity and efficacy of the dental restoration. Premature consumption of food, particularly hard or sticky substances, can compromise the integrity of a newly placed filling, potentially leading to chipping, dislodgement, or increased sensitivity. Furthermore, proper setting of the filling material minimizes the risk of bacterial infiltration and subsequent recurrent decay around the filling margins. 8+ Safe Wait: Hydroxyzine & Alcohol? Get Info Now!

The interaction between hydroxyzine, an antihistamine and anxiolytic, and alcohol, a central nervous system depressant, presents potential risks. Understanding the duration of this interaction is critical for patient safety. The combination can amplify the sedative effects of both substances, leading to impaired coordination, slowed reaction times, and increased drowsiness. This potentiation can pose a significant danger, particularly when operating machinery or driving.

Assessing the appropriate interval between consuming alcohol and taking hydroxyzine, or vice versa, is essential to mitigate these adverse effects. Individual factors such as age, weight, liver function, and dosage of hydroxyzine all influence the duration of drug effects.
